Ilse Strauss-Weisz serves as Lecturer in Teaching Practice & Recorder Didactics at Mozarteum University's Department of Music Education in Innsbruck, operating under the School of Music and Art Education. She combines academic instruction with active artistic practice through private lessons and ensemble leadership.
Her professional focus centers on:
- Developing innovative music education methodologies for children and youth
- Advancing recorder didactics and historical performance practices
- Creating interdisciplinary concert experiences through historical research
- Designing accessible concert formats for new audiences
Strauss-Weisz founded Ensemble Rosarum Flores to explore cross-disciplinary programming and co-initiated ConTakt, Tyrol's early music platform, where she investigates performance practice and novel concert structures over eight years of active research. She maintains significant institutional partnerships including the Tyrolean Regional Museums, Innsbruck Festival of Early Music, youth baroque orchestra Streicherey, and Innsbrucker Abendmusik concert series. As specialist group leader for recorder education at Innsbruck's municipal music school, she directly shapes contemporary teaching approaches while addressing unexpected challenges of historical instrument performance.
